STM32F769I-EVAL Series
The STM32F769I-EVAL evaluation board is a complete demonstration and development platform for STMicroelectronics ARM®Cortex®-M7 core-based STM32F769NI microcontrollers. It features the following interfaces: four I2Cs, six SPIs with three multiplexed full-duplex I2S, SDIO, two SAIs, 8- to 14-bit digital camera module, Ethernet MAC, FMC and Quad-SPI. It also features four USART and four UART peripherals, two CAN bus, three 12-bit ADC converters, two 12-bit DAC channels, internal 256+4-Kbyte SRAM and 2-Mbyte Flash memory, USB HS OTG and USB FS OTG peripherals, JTAG debugging support. This evaluation board can be used as a reference design for user application development but it is not considered as a final application.
The full range of hardware features on the board helps the user to evaluate all the peripherals (USB OTG HS, USB OTG FS, Ethernet, motor control, CAN, microSD card, USART, audio DAC and ADC, digital microphone, CAN, SRAM, NOR Flash, SDRAM, Quad-SPI Flash, 4" DSI LCD with capacitive touch panel etc.) and to develop applications. Extension headers make it possible to easily connect a daughterboard for a specific application.
The integrated ST-LINK/V2-1 provides an embedded in-circuit debugger and programmer for the STM32.
